== XSS Overview == '''XSS''' (sometimes referred to as '''XBS''') is the operating system used by the Xbox 360 family of consoles and dev/test hardware. It evolved from the original Xbox OS, which itself was a heavily customized Windows NT / Windows 2000–derived kernel, and it underpins the dashboard, recovery system, device drivers, and developer tooling for the platform.
